About Yi Qi
Yi Qi is a scholar working on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Biomedical Engineering,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, having authored 119 papers that have together received 4.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advanced MRI Techniques and Applications (28 papers), Advanced Neuroimaging Techniques and Applications (16 papers), MRI in cancer diagnosis (10 papers), Advanced X-ray and CT Imaging (10 papers), Medical Imaging Techniques and Applications (10 papers), Functional Brain Connectivity Studies (9 papers), Semiconductor materials and devices (9 papers) and Advancements in Semiconductor Devices and Circuit Design (9 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ging (892 citations), Biomedical Engineering (1.4k citations), Hepatology (171 citations),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ials (391 citations) and Condensed Matter Physics (242 citations). Yi Qi has collaborated with scholars based in United States, China and Germany. Frequent co-authors include G. Allan Johnson, Michael C. McAlpine, John Cumings, Todd Brintlinger, Cristian T. Badea, Anna Mae Diehl, Gary P. Cofer, Jihoon Kim, Prashant K. Purohit and Thanh D. Nguyen. Their work appears in journals such as Magnetic Resonance in Medicine, NMR in Biomedicine, NeuroImage, Medical Physics and Nano Letters.
